Following Virat Kohli's retirement from Test cricket, 14-year-old Vaibhav Suryavanshi caught fans’ attention during the first Youth Test between India U19 and England U19. The young batter was seen wearing jersey number 18, famously worn by Kohli throughout his international career and in the IPL.

Suryavanshi is currently in England for a multi-format series against England U19. The left-handed batter registered scores of 48 (19), 45 (34), 86 (31), 143 (78), and 33 (42) in the five Youth ODIs, where the Men in Blue secured a 3-2 win. He continued his form in red-ball cricket during the ongoing tour.

Vaibhav Suryavanshi Wears No. 18 Jersey After Virat Kohli’s Test Retirement

Vaibhav Suryavanshi grabbed headlines during the first Youth Test between India U19 and England U19 after stepping onto the field in Virat Kohli's jersey number 18. It came just months after Virat Kohli retired from Test cricket. Notably, Suryavanshi had worn jersey number 12 during the IPL 2025 season.

Virat Kohli has been wearing jersey number 18 since his early days in U-19 cricket. He continued to wear the same number throughout his red-ball career. Kohli described his decision to retire from Test cricket as tough. However, Virat Kohli will continue to represent India in ODI cricket.

Vaibhav Suryavanshi Becomes Youngest Ever to Take a Wicket in Youth Test History

Vaibhav Suryavanshi scored a half-century in the first Youth Test. After scoring just 14 in the first innings, the 14-year-old bounced back with 56 off 44 balls in the second innings, which included nine fours and a six. He reached his half-century in just 39 balls before being dismissed by Archie Vaughan.

Earlier in the match, Suryavanshi made history by becoming the youngest player ever to take a wicket in a Youth Test, at just 14 years and 107 days. He also claimed the wicket of England U19 captain Hamza Shaikh and finished with bowling figures of 2 for 35 from 12 overs.

The match between India U19 and England U19 ended in a draw. India posted 540 runs in their first innings before bowling the English side out for 439. The visitors managed 248 runs in their second innings, while England reached 270/7 by the end of play.

Vaibhav Suryavanshi Set to Feature in Second Youth Test Against England

Vaibhav Suryavanshi has become one of India’s most exciting young talents. He scored the fastest century by an Indian in IPL history, smashing 101 runs off just 38 balls for the Rajasthan Royals (RR) against Shubman Gill’s Gujarat Titans (GT).

The left-hander tallied 252 runs in seven matches at a blistering strike rate of 206.55. His explosive batting earned him the “Super Striker of the Season” award.

Suryavanshi amassed 355 runs in the five-match Youth ODI series against England U19, playing a key role in India’s 3-2 victory. He hammered a century in the fourth ODI at Worcester. He will next be seen in action during the second Youth Test against England, starting on July 20.
